About 4IQ

4IQ has developed a Cyber Intelligence product that supports the full intelligence cycle. It integrates internal and external OSINT sources like the visible web, social media & Deep and Dark web. The 4iQ Threat Intelligence platform is a defense grade integrated response system in the field of data mining. It is capable of configuring threat alerts and visualize trends in order to provide you with information for better intelligence production. On December 15th 2020, 4IQ merged with Constella Intelligence.

Irth Solutions Acquires 4iQ Solutions, an 811 Call Center Notification, Damage Prevention, and Training System Provider

Oct 17, 2022

News Provided By Share This Article Irth Solutions expands its risk managemnet and damage prevention solutions with the acquisition of 4iQ Solutions. 4iQ brings a very deep data set and valuable experience with machine learning to better manage risk and prevent damage.” — Brad Gammons, CEO, Irth Solutions COLUMBUS, OHIO, UNITED STATES, October 17, 2022 / EINPresswire.com / -- Irth Solutions (“Irth”), a leading provider of SaaS solutions focused on reducing risk and improving the resiliency of critical network infrastructure, announced they acquired 4iQ Solutions (“4iQ”). 4iQ provides damage prevention, risk management, and learning management solutions. Its team has a reputation for innovation and deep industry expertise, which will complement Irth’s offerings to provide asset owners one of the most comprehensive risk management and damage prevention solutions in the market. “4iQ drives innovation and creates solutions that provide value and insight for our clients. Our focus on reducing damages and near misses with better data, more thorough training, and better controls are seen in our product offerings,” said Jason Adams, CEO of 4iQ. “Joining the Irth family will allow us to work with the great team and continue our goal of making the world safer and more resilient.” “4iQ brings a very deep data set and valuable experience with machine learning to better manage risk and prevent damage. Additionally, 4iQ brings specific predefined training processes with its learning management system to enhance service delivery and further reduce risk,” said Brad Gammons, CEO of Irth Solutions. About Irth Solutions Irth Solutions, a Blackstone Portfolio company headquartered in Columbus, Ohio, is the leading provider of SaaS solutions for damage prevention, risk management, and asset protection to improve the resilience of critical network infrastructure, including its flagship 811 ticket management solution. Clients have trusted Irth Solutions for decades to manage and reduce risk, decrease costs, increase revenue opportunities, and ensure regulatory compliance—artificial intelligence and analytics power additional insights for the early detection of emerging problems. Irth Solutions has helped hundreds of customers execute the work most important to their success in a world where safety, resilience, and reliability are paramount. About 4iQ 4iQ serves some of the most significant One Call centers in the nation. Its market-leading software solution utilizes real-time data to help users manage the entire notification process to ensure accuracy and reduce the workload on call center staff. Flashpoint Logo
Flashpoint

Flashpoint delivers business risk intelligence (BRI) services. It offers actionable threat intelligence and automation software designed to protect from fraud, detect insider threats, offer cybersecurity, enhance physical security, and more. The company was founded in 2010 and is based in New York, New York.

Cybersixgill Logo
Cybersixgill

Cybersixgill is a cyber threat intelligence company that covertly and automatically analyzes Dark Web activity detecting and preventing cyber-attacks and sensitive data leaks before they occur. Utilizing advanced algorithms, Cybersixgill's cyber intelligence platform provides organizations with continuous monitoring, prioritized real-time alerts, and actionable intelligence. Through advanced data mining and social profiling, Cybersixgill examines threat actors and their patterns of behavior, identifying and predicting cybercrime and terrorist activity.

Cobwebs Technologies Logo
Cobwebs Technologies

Cobwebs Technologies platform enables law enforcers, analysts, policymakers, and decision-makers the power to effectively manage uncertainty and new challenges. The company specializes in developing cyber intelligence solutions for enforcement bodies, national security agencies, and financial services worldwide. It was founded in 2015 and is based in New York, New York.

Recorded Future Logo
Recorded Future

Recorded Future provides intelligence-related solutions to reveal unknown threats. It delivers threat intelligence powered by patented machine learning to lower risk, empowering organizations to reveal unknown threats before they impact business and enabling teams to respond to security alerts. The company was founded in 2009 and is based in Somerville, Massachusetts. In May 2019, Recorded Future was acquired by Insight Partners.

Intel 471 Logo
Intel 471

Intel 471 provides cyber security and cybercrime intelligence services to enterprises, government agencies, and other organizations. The company provides adversary, malware intelligence, and coverage of the criminal underground and focuses on getting access to closed sources where threat actors collaborate, communicate and plan cyber attacks. The company was founded in 2014 and is based in Prosper, Texas.

Cyble Logo
Cyble

Cyble provides a cyber intelligence platform. It offers attack surface management, brand intelligence, cyber threat intelligence, dark web and deep web, vulnerability management, and more. It helps organizations assess cybersecurity risks in their supply chain and provides customized notifications of hazards and risks related to their enterprise, operations, and supply chain. It allows companies to manage cyber-secure workflows with their vendors using an artificial intelligence (AI)-powered security scoring mechanism. The company was founded in 2019 and is based in Alpharetta, Georgia.
